    Harrison County School District Statistics

    The Harrison County School District is located in Cynthiana, KY and includes 8 schools that serve 3,208 students in grades PK through 12.  

    District Spending

    The Harrison County School District spends $7,747 per pupil in current expenditures.  The district spends 59% on instruction, 34% on support services, and 7% on other elementary and secondary expenditures.

    District Student-Teacher Ratio

    The Harrison County School District has 17 students for every full-time equivalent teacher, with the KY state average being 15 students per full-time equivalent teacher.  

    District Student Information

    The Harrison County School District had a grades 9-12 dropout rate of 3% in 2008.  The national grades 9-12 dropout rate in 2007 was 4.4%.  

    In the Harrison County School District, 16% of students have an IEP (Individualized Education Program).  An IEP is a written plan for students eligible for special needs services.  

    The Harrison County School District serves 1% English Language Learners (ELL).  ELL students are in the process of acquiring and learning English Language skills.  

    Source: NCES, 2008
